PENGARUH PENDIDIKAN KESEHATAN TENTANG MENCUCI TANGAN TERHADAP PENGETAHUAN DI MASA COVID 19 PADA ANAK SEKOLAH Elsi Rahmadani; Marlin Sutrisna

Abstract

Every year, 3.5 million children die from diarrheal diseases and ARI and Covid 19 which can be minimized by washing hands. The purpose of this study was to determine the effect of health education on hand washing on knowledge of students at MIN 2 Bengkulu City. The method used is a method with a pre and post one group Quasi Experiment approach. The sample in this study amounted to 23 respondents using total sampling technique. This study uses SPSS with the Wilcoxon test bivariate statistical test with a value of = <0.05. The results of the univariate analysis showed that the average knowledge value before was 5.30 and the average knowledge value after health education on washing hands was 12.87. The results of the bivariate analysis showed that there was an effect of health education on hand washing on students' knowledge (p value = 0.000). Researchers suggest that schools can routinely provide learning about health, especially about washing hands for elementary school children.
HUBUNGAN TINGKAT ANXIETY DENGAN KONTROL ASMA BRONKIAL Marlin Sutrisna; Elsi Rahmadani

Abstract

Bronchial asthma is still a health problem that is included in the top 10 deadly diseases in the world. The purpose of this study was to determine the relationship between Anxiety Levels and Control of Bronchial Asthma. The type of research used is descriptive research with a cross sectional research design. The place of research was carried out at the Sukamerindu Health Center in 2020. The sample in this study was bronchial asthma patients, totaling 30 respondents. Measurement of anxiety level using the HARS scale instrument and measurement of bronchial asthma control using the ACT (Asthma Control Test) instrument. Data were analyzed by chi-square. The results showed that more than some respondents had controlled asthma and more than some respondents did not experience anxiety (normal). The results of the chi-square statistical test showed that there was a relationship between anxiety levels and control of bronchial asthma in the Sukamerindu Pueskesmas Work Area, Bengkulu City. The conclusion in this study is that the level of anxiety can affect the control of bronchial asthma. Researchers suggest that the Sukamerindu Public Health Center can provide education to asthma patients so that they can control their anxiety so that asthma becomes more controlled.
